- Description
- The Fleet and Industrial Supply Center (FISC) Norfolk Detachment Philadlephia intends to solicit on an other than full and open competition basis, engineering and technical services in support of the U.S. Joint Forces Command's Joint C4ISR Battle Center. Services are required in support of the analysis of existing and near term technology insertion for the joint war fighter. An estimated 34,600 man hours of support are required during the period from 1 September 2003 through 31 December 2003. The services will be provided through a modification to contract N00140-99-D-H032 with General Dynamics Corp. The procurement is being processed through other than full and open competition pursuant to the statutory authority of 10 U.S.C. 2304(c)(1), as implemented by FAR 6.302-1. The purpose of this acquisition is to allow sufficient time to complete the procurement process for the competitive follow-on. The follow-on requirement has been solicited under request for proposals N00140-04-R-H001 and is still under evaluation. Contract N00140-99-D-H032 is an indefinite quantity, indefinite delivery contract with task orders issued on a cost plus fixed fee basis. The Government intends to solicit and negotiate with General Dynamics since they are the only source that currently has the requisite personnel in place to perform the required services. Interested persons may identify their interest and capability to respond to the requirement. This notice of intent is not a request for competitive proposals. However, the Government will consider all proposals received within forty-five days after the date of publication of this synopsis. Information received as a result of this notice of intent will normally be considered solely for the purpose of determining whether to conduct a competitive procurement. A determination by the Government not to compete this proposed procurement action based on the responses received is solely with the discretion of the Government. The Government will not pay for information received. The NAICS code is 541512 and the small business size standard is $21 million. Numbered notes 22 and 26 apply.
